BPH921 High Sensitivity CMOS Hall-Effect Switch General Description The BPH921 is a Hall-effect latch designed in mixed signal CMOS technology. It is quite suitable for use in automotive, industrial and consumer applications. Superior high-temperature performance is made possible through dynamic offset cancellation, which reduces the residual offset voltage normally caused by device overmolding, temperature dependencies, and thermal stress. The device integrates a voltage regulator, Hall-voltage generator, small-signal amplifier, chopper stabilization, Schmitt trigger, and is directly drivable by the output. An integrated voltage regulator permits operation with supply voltage from 3.5V to 24V.
